Let me guess....you have Word as part of Works Suite. In that situation, the wonderful folks at Microsoft have decided that launching Word will clear the clipboard, hence what you copied is banished to memory purgatory forever and you are forced to recopy to allow the paste. If it really hinders your efficiency you can remedy it by going to the add/remove programs in the Contol Panel and removing the Works Suite add-in for Word. (Or install one of the many 3rd party enhanced clipboard programs.)

Here is the fix for this very annoying problem, which I'm posting two months after the question was asked for anyone still searching the archives:

In the root directory, Program Files\Microsoft Works, delete the wkwdaddn.dll file.

Now Word can paste whether or not it was open before copying. I have not found any other problems caused by this solution.
